Abstract

The present invention is to provide a liquid crystal display device in which, even when a columnar spacer is misaligned, the columnar spacer can be light-shielded without reduction of an aperture ratio. According to the present invention, there is provided a liquid crystal display device which includes a pair of substrates spaced at a distance from each other by a plurality of columnar spacers, and a liquid crystal layer sandwiched between the pair of substrates, and in which a pixel is formed by picture elements of a plurality of colors, the liquid crystal display device being featured in that one of the pair of substrates includes colored layers of a plurality of colors, and a light shielding layer, in that at least one of the colored layers of the plurality of colors has a region in which a colored layer of the same color is integrally arranged on respective picture elements adjacent to each other, and has a straight portion and an extension portion extending from the straight portion, in that at least one of the plurality of columnar spacers is provided at a position overlapping with the extension portion, and has a substantially rhombus-shaped surface or a substantially circular surface, which is in contact with the substrate, and the contour line of the extension portion has a shape corresponding to the contour line of the columnar spacer provided at the position overlapping with the extension portion.
